Problems solved by technology

The traditional wire braiding machine pays off the wire through the friction pay-off assembly. When the wire is pulled to a certain position, the friction plate at the bottom of the bobbin is separated from the main body, and the bobbin rotates. The tension of the wire is determined by the actual spring specification. The friction plate cannot have oil, but The rotation of the spindle requires oil lubrication, and the lubricating oil inevitably enters the friction plate, affecting the tension
[0003] Spool capacity is 610CM 3 , the spool capacity is small, the spools are replaced frequently, which affects the weaving progress (speed) and increases the labor level
The highest output speed is 1440MM per minute, and the weaving efficiency is low
When the bobbin is rotated, one end is positioned, and when one end of the bobbin is positioned, the rotation is not smooth, which affects the tension, and the bobbin wears a lot

Abstract

The invention provides a spindle of a steel wire knitting machine. The spindle of the steel wire knitting machine comprises a wire pay-off mechanism, a wire shaft and a spindle body; a steel wire is coiled on the wire shaft; the wire pay-off mechanism and the wire shaft are mounted on the spindle body; the steel wire on the wire shaft is regularly unwound through the wire pay-off mechanism and the spindle body; the spindle body comprises a spindle pedestal and a spindle main body; a polish rod I, a polish rod II, a polish rod III, a lower shifting fork and an upper shifting fork are arranged above the spindle main body; the lower shifting fork penetrates through the polish rod I and the polish rod II; the lower shifting fork is provided with two guide wheels; the upper shifting fork is provided with two guide wheels; a guide bracket is arranged between every two guide wheels; the upper end of each guide bracket is provided with a universal bearing; the spindle main body is provided with a guide wheel fixing block on which one guide wheel is arranged. According to the spindle provided by the invention, integrated guide wheels are adopted, so the guide wheels can rotate more smoothly.

Description

technical field [0001] The invention relates to a steel wire braiding machine spindle and belongs to the technical field of steel wire braiding machines. Background technique [0002] The steel wire braided pipe has strong compression and deformation resistance, and has a broad application market. The steel wire braided pipe is woven by a steel wire braiding machine. The traditional wire braiding machine pays off the wire through the friction pay-off assembly. When the wire is pulled to a certain position, the friction plate at the bottom of the bobbin is separated from the main body, and the bobbin rotates. The tension of the wire is determined by the actual spring specification. The friction plate cannot have oil, but The rotation of the spindle requires oil lubrication, and the lubricating oil inevitably enters the friction plate and affects the tension.
